I normally do not play a lot with options in some of Puppy's utilities.
But I was running Puppy Lupu 520 and decided to try some of the options in partview.
When I would select DETAILS and choose a partition, I would get a blank xdialog window with no information shown.
From there, I opened /tmp/xerrs.log I saw that the du command was complaining about parameters such as:

du: invalid option -- 'd'
du: invalid option -- '1'
Try `du --help' for more information.

So I think those invalid options were stopping du from working and resulting in the empty xdialog window in DETAILS.

Can someone verify this and is there a solution other than editing the partview file and removing the invalid options?

8-bit wrote:So are you saying that the du command changed in later versions to include more options?
Yes.
If I make a modified script excluding those options, it will show the files in a directory with sizes of them.
That's true. But I find it more useful to see the total sizes of the top-level directories, instead of all the individual files. The new versions of du can do this.

Well, I just renamed du in Lupu520 and then copied du from Precise 5.7.1 to that location and DETAILS in partview now work.
